Jigawa State Government trains 160 young women on waste recycling

By Ahmad Alabira, Dutse

In a bid to promote environmental sustainability and empower women, another set of 160 young women are undergoing a four day training on waste recycling at the Gumel Emirate Foundation in Jigawa state.

The training which was organized on Wednesday by the Jigawa state Environmental Protection Agency (JISEPA) is supported by the United Nations Children Education Fund (UNICEF).

Briefing newsmen at the venue of the programme, Gumel Council Chairman, Honourable Lawan Ya’u Abdullahi said the training, is aimed at equipping women with skills to lead environmental conservation efforts in their communities.

The Chairman urged the trainees to train more women in their neighborhoods, emphasized the importance of community-led initiatives.

He assured that the council would continue to support the training of women across all electoral wards, with at least five women benefiting from the program in each ward.

Also speaking, the Director JISEPA, Sanitarium Adamu Sabo explained that the workshop focused on recycling waste into useful products that can be sold in local markets within and outside the state. 

Sabo encouraged the women to take the training seriously, emphasizing its potential to improve their economic well-being.

He further stressed that the program was sponsored by the JISEPA in conjunction with UNICEF, among others.

He then assured the women that their products would be marketed locally, to provide them with a source of incomes.

“The training is part of a broader effort to promote environmental sustainability and empower women in Jigawa State. 

“By equipping women with skills and knowledge, the program aims to create a ripple effect of positive change in communities across the state.

“We will soon come out with another programme to further clear our rural and urban centres of dirty wastes as well as keep our environment clean,” he concluded.
